Tigers Roar Past Phillies with Seventh Inning Surge at Citizens Bank Park

First Inning


The Detroit Tigers, now standing at 65-47, clashed with the Philadelphia Phillies, who hold a 62-48 record. The game unfolded under the bright lights of Citizens Bank Park. Both teams started cautiously, with neither side managing to score in the opening inning. The Tigers managed a hit but were unable to convert it into runs.

Third Inning


The third inning saw the Motor City Kitties break through as they scored 2 runs off 2 hits. This early lead was crucial in setting the tone for their performance throughout the game. Spencer Torkelson and Javier Báez were instrumental during this period, contributing significantly to their team's offensive efforts.


Seventh Inning


A pivotal moment came in the seventh inning when both teams turned up their offensive heat. The Tigers added another 3 runs from 3 hits and capitalized on an error by Philadelphia's defense. This surge was mirrored by a response from the Phils who also scored 3 runs off of their own set of hits.


Eighth Inning


In what became one of the most decisive innings, Detroit extended its lead further by scoring an additional 2 runs from just one hit while maintaining defensive composure against Philadelphia's attempts to close in on them.


Ninth Inning


The final inning saw no further scoring from either team as Detroit held onto its advantage firmly till closing time at Citizens Bank Park with a final scoreline reading: Tigers -7 and Phillies -5.


Throughout this encounter between these two formidable sides there were several standout performances worth noting; Kerry Carpenter showcased his batting prowess alongside Colt Keith whose contributions proved vital towards securing victory for his team today!
